在互联网环境中,给他人网站挂黑链是一种违反法律法规和道德规范的行为,属于黑帽SEO手段,会对目标网站造成严重损害,包括搜索引擎降权、用户信息安全风险甚至法律责任,以下从技术原理、危害及法律风险角度进行说明,旨在帮助用户了解此类行为的危害,而非提供操作指导。

挂黑链的技术原理与常见手段
挂黑链通常指通过非法手段在目标网站的网页代码中植入恶意链接,这些链接可能指向赌博、色情、诈骗等非法网站或低质量广告页面,其实现方式主要包括以下几种:
-
漏洞入侵
利用目标网站存在的未修复漏洞(如SQL注入、文件上传漏洞、后台弱口令等),获取服务器权限后直接修改网页文件,在HTML代码中添加黑链,通过上传webshell脚本控制服务器,批量植入链接。 -
跨站脚本(XSS)攻击
若目标网站存在XSS漏洞,攻击者可构造恶意脚本,诱导用户点击或自动执行,从而在用户浏览器中加载黑链,这种攻击无需直接修改网站文件,但可利用网站漏洞实现链路传播。 -
篡改第三方服务
部分网站依赖第三方组件(如评论区、留言板、广告系统),攻击者可通过篡改第三方服务的接口或内容,在合法位置插入黑链,利用未过滤的用户输入功能,在评论区提交包含链接的恶意内容。(图片来源网络,侵删) -
供应链攻击
针对使用CMS(如WordPress、DedeCMS)的网站,攻击者可能利用系统模板、插件的漏洞,或通过破解管理员账号,在全局模板文件中植入黑链,使所有页面都包含恶意链接。
挂黑链的危害与法律风险
-
对目标网站的损害
- 搜索引擎惩罚:搜索引擎(如百度、Google)会检测并惩罚包含黑链的网站,导致关键词排名下降、网站权重降低,甚至被彻底索引移除。
- 用户信任度崩塌:黑链可能指向非法或欺诈网站,导致用户遭遇信息泄露、财产损失,严重损害网站品牌形象。
- 服务器资源消耗:大量黑链会增加服务器带宽和负载,影响网站正常访问速度。
-
法律后果
根据《中华人民共和国网络安全法》第二十七条、《刑法》第二百八十五条等相关规定,非法侵入他人计算机系统、篡改网页内容、传播非法信息,可能构成非法侵入计算机信息系统罪、破坏计算机信息系统罪,面临拘役、有期徒刑等刑事处罚,并承担民事赔偿责任,黑链传播的违法内容(如赌博、淫秽信息)会进一步加重法律责任。
如何防范网站被挂黑链
网站管理员应采取以下措施保护网站安全:

- 定期更新系统与插件:及时修补CMS、服务器软件及第三方组件的漏洞。
- 强化权限管理:使用复杂密码,开启双因素认证,限制后台登录IP。
- 输入过滤与输出编码:对用户提交内容进行严格过滤,对页面输出进行HTML编码,防止XSS攻击。
- 定期安全扫描:使用专业工具(如漏洞扫描器、Web应用防火墙)检测网站异常链接和恶意代码。
- 备份数据:定期备份网站文件和数据库,以便在遭受攻击后快速恢复。
相关问答FAQs
Q1:发现网站被挂黑链后应如何处理?
A:应立即采取以下步骤:
- 隔离网站:暂时关闭网站或切换至维护页面,防止黑链进一步传播。
- 清除黑链:全站扫描网页文件,删除恶意代码,并检查数据库中是否被注入恶意数据。
- 修复漏洞:通过日志分析找出入侵途径,修补相关漏洞(如更新系统、修复SQL注入点)。
- 提交申诉:若网站被搜索引擎降权,可向百度搜索资源平台或Google Search Console提交申诉说明情况。
- 加强防护:部署Web应用防火墙(WAF),定期进行安全审计。
Q2:挂黑链是否可以通过技术手段隐藏?
A:部分黑链会采用隐藏技术逃避检测,
- CSS隐藏:将链接字体颜色设置为与背景相同,或通过
display:none
属性隐藏。 - JS动态加载:利用JavaScript在页面加载后动态插入链接,绕过静态代码扫描。
- 跳转页面:通过短链接或中间页跳转到恶意网站,增加追踪难度。
但隐藏技术并非绝对,搜索引擎和安全工具可通过分析页面行为、链接特征识别黑链,且隐藏行为本身仍属于违规操作,无法规避法律风险。